Tree removal services involve the careful cutting and extraction of trees that are no longer suitable for a property or pose potential hazards. This process typically includes assessing the tree’s health and stability, planning the safest way to remove it, and then using specialized tools and equipment to cut the tree into manageable sections. The goal is to ensure the tree is removed efficiently while minimizing impact on the surrounding landscape. These services are often necessary when a tree has become too large, diseased, or damaged, making it a risk to the property or nearby structures.

Many problems can be solved through professional tree removal. Dead or dying trees can become weak and fall unexpectedly, causing damage or injury. Trees with extensive rot or disease might threaten the stability of the landscape, and removing them can prevent accidents. Additionally, trees that are growing too close to power lines, buildings, or other structures may need to be removed to prevent interference or damage. Clearing space for new construction or landscaping projects is another common reason homeowners seek tree removal services, ensuring the property remains safe and functional.

The overview below groups typical Tree Removal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nineveh,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Tree Removal - Typically costs between $250 and $600 for routine jobs like removing a single small tree or trimming branches. Many local contractors handle these projects frequently within this range. Larger or more complex jobs may cost more but are less common.

Medium-Sized Tree Removal - Projects involving medium trees usually fall between $600 and $1,500. This range covers most standard tree removals in the Nineveh area. Fewer jobs reach into the higher end for larger or more challenging trees.

Large Tree Removal - Removing larger trees can range from $1,500 to $3,000 or more, depending on size and location. Many local pros handle these jobs regularly within this band, though very large or difficult projects can push above $3,000.

Full Tree Removal and Stump Grinding - Complete removal, including stump grinding, often costs $2,000 to $5,000+ for extensive projects. These are less common and tend to involve larger, more complex trees or properties requiring spec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if a tree needs to be removed? Signs that a tree may require removal include dead or dying branches, structural instability, or damage from storms. Consulting with local contractors can help assess the tree's condition accurately.

What factors influence the complexity of a tree removal? The size, location, and health of the tree, as well as nearby structures or utilities, can affect the complexity of the removal process. Experienced service providers can evaluate these aspects to determine the scope of work.

Are there any permits required for tree removal in Nineveh, IN? Permit requirements vary based on local regulations and the property's specifics. Local contractors can advise on whether permits are necessary before proceeding with removal.

What safety precautions are typically involved in tree removal? Safety measures often include the use of protective gear, proper equipment, and careful planning to prevent damage or injury. Professional service providers follow standard safety protocols during the job.

Can a damaged or diseased tree be safely removed? Yes, trees that are dead, diseased, or structurally compromised can usually be removed safely by experienced contractors to prevent potential hazards.
